Eskom complies with court order on Koeberg steam

Tuesday, October 28, 2014

Pretoria - Eskom has complied with a court ruling to hand over documents relating to the Koeberg steam generator replacement matter, it said on Monday.

“Westinghouse has made repeated assertions that Eskom refuses to provide it with documents relating to the Koeberg Steam Generator Replacement matter. Eskom reiterates that it has complied fully with the terms of the Order of Court of September 5 2014,” it said in a statement.

Westinghouse had initially wanted to get an interdict to stop the parastatal from either signing a contract with Areva or implementing the contract if it had already signed it.

Westinghouse had filed an urgent application to the court in order to see documentation relating to Eskom’s awarding of the R4 billion tender.

Further, Eskom has to date, through its attorneys, made available to Westinghouse’s attorneys numerous confidential documents.

“It is also on this basis that Eskom agreed to the confidentiality regime which was incorporated by agreement between the parties into the Court Order of September. 

“Eskom remains confident that the courts will confirm that Eskom has acted within the prescribed procedures throughout the process.” – SAnews.gov.za
